Study On The Community Structure And Ecological Adaptation Of Soil Scarab Under The Condition Of Different Water-Soil Erosion Controlling Methods In Huangfu-chuan Watershed

The study plots were located in Wufendi and Yangquan ravine, Huangfu-chuan watershed in Inner Mongolia.Five controlling methods of water-soil erosion,i.e.,pine woodland,aspen woodland,artificial shrub,artificial-planded weadow and abandoned cropland were sampling sites.And farmland,grassland and degenerated grassland were controlling sites.Soil sampling and bait trap were used to collect soil scarabs in 2007 - 2008.The soil scarab community construction,community similarity,species diversity, niches and ecological adaptation were analysed.The main results as follows.1.A total of 6 999 soil scarabs belonging to 4 families,12 genus and 21 species were captured.Among them,1 041 were of shytophagous scarab imago and larvea belonging to 2 families,6 genus and 7 species.The dominant species are Serica orientalis and Diphycerus davidis.And 5 958 were of coprophagous scarabs belonging to 2 families,6 genus and 14 species. The dominant species are Aphodius rectus and Onthophagus gibbulus.2.Compared to control sites,the individual numbers and biomass of shytophagous scarab were increased under in different water-soil erosion controlling methods sites.But the individual numbers of coprophagous scarabs were not significant increase.And the biomass of them were decrease on the contrary.In different water-soil erosion controlling methods sites,the dominant species of shytophagous scarab communities were same as that of in control sites,the number of dominant species of coprophagous scarab communities were higher than that of in control sites.It was especially that the community of coprophagous scarab in pine woodland was monodominant community which with Onthophagus sinicus. 3.Based on the analysis of community similarity,the soil scarab communities in different sampling sites can be divided into four kinds.The first kind were distributed in grassland and degenerated grassland.The second one were distributed in aspen woodland,artificial shrub and farmland.The third one were distributed in artificial-planted meadow,farmland and abandoned cropland.The fourth one were distributed in pine woodland.4.As the different water-soil erosion controlling methods put in practice in Wufendi ravine,the diversity of shytophagous scarab community was significantly inhanced comparing to control sites.But the diversity of coprophagous scarab community was not significantly changed.5.The results that from the partial correlation and CCA between soil scarab community and environmental factors indicated that the main environmental factors which affected soil scarabs were water content of soil, total phosphorus of soil,condition of vegetation and available phosphorus of soil.
